dc.description.abstractIn this paper, segmentation techniques depending on T-ray CT functional imaging [1] are investigated. A set of linear image fusion and novel wavelet scale correlation segmentation techniques are adopted in order to achieve classification within 3D objects. The methods are applied to a T-ray CT image dataset of a glass vial containing a plastic tube. This experiment simulates the imaging of a simple nested organic structure, which will provide an indication of the potential for using T-ray CT imaging to achieve T-ray pulsed signal classification of heterogeneous layers.-
